💡 Growing Tips for Beet
Soak seeds overnight before planting. Thin seedlings to 8cm. Can be planted 2-3 weeks before the last expected frost, giving it a head start on the growing season. Aim for about 2.5 cm of water per week, adjusting for rainfall. Organic mulch around the base helps maintain even moisture.
Frost tolerance: Beet is frost tolerant — you can plant earlier in spring.

How to Grow Beet in Bordeaux
Bordeaux, FR is in USDA Hardiness Zone 7 with a Oceanic / Marine west coast climate (Köppen Cfb). With winter lows of 2°C and summer highs of 27°C, the growing season spans approximately 260 frost-free days. Beet grows well with some gardening knowledge in this climate.
Beet thrives in temperatures between 10°C and 22°C, requiring full sun and regular watering. In Bordeaux, the best months to plant Beet are January, February, March, September, October. Since Beet can tolerate frost, you have flexibility to plant earlier in the season or extend into cooler months. Expect to harvest in approximately 50-70 days after planting.
With 944mm of annual rainfall, Bordeaux provides moderate natural moisture. You'll likely need to supplement with regular watering, especially during the growing season.
